Course Content

• Introduction to International Relations: Key Concepts and Theories
• Global Politics and Governance: Actors and Institutions (Keywords: International Organizations, Diplomacy)
• International Security: Conflict, Peacekeeping, and Terrorism (Keywords: Security Studies, Conflict Resolution)
• International Political Economy: Trade, Finance, and Development (Keywords: Globalization, Economic Development)
• Human Rights and International Law: Protecting Vulnerable Populations
• Environmental Politics and Sustainability: Global Challenges (Keywords: Climate Change, Environmental Diplomacy)
• The Role of Non-State Actors: NGOs, MNCs, and IGOs (Keywords: Civil Society, Multinational Corporations)
• International Relations Theories in Practice: Case Studies

Career path

Career Role (International Relations) Description
International Relations Analyst Analyze global political and economic trends, providing strategic insights for organizations. High demand for strong analytical skills and international relations knowledge.
Diplomat (UK Foreign Office) Represent the UK's interests abroad, negotiating treaties and promoting international cooperation. Requires advanced knowledge in international relations and diplomacy.
International Development Officer (NGO) Work with NGOs on humanitarian aid projects and international development initiatives. Excellent communication and project management skills are essential.
Global Policy Consultant Advise businesses and governments on international policy issues. Requires expertise in international relations and policy analysis.
Trade Negotiator (International Organizations) Negotiate trade agreements on behalf of international organizations. Excellent communication and negotiation skills are necessary. Strong understanding of international trade.
